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7832789 4510276 4904359
6913588 094 961759
6913588 094 961759
72 532733 884 8281
All about undefined
Interested in learning more?
6913588 094 961759
72 532733 884 8281
See more
08 86925027
97375 4278502286 84386 26476
See more
140878244 536619 6585
295784126 0902022044 7095482
See more